πŸ“š The Reality Every Fresher Faces

As placement season approaches, most students focus on learning programming languages, solving DSA problems, revising DBMS, OS, CN, and building projects. While these are all important, there's another challenge many of us overlook:

The interview itself.

You might know the answer to a question, but explaining it confidently under pressure is a completely different skill.

Many students struggle with:

😰 Interview nervousness
πŸ’¬ Communicating technical concepts clearly
πŸ€” Answering unexpected questions
πŸ“– Identifying gaps in their preparation

The good news is that AI is making interview preparation more accessible than ever.

πŸ’‘ A Smarter Placement Preparation Strategy

Instead of only studying theory, consider building a routine that combines learning with regular practice.

Here's a simple approach:

βœ… Revise one technical subject every week.

βœ… Practice coding consistently.

βœ… Work on real projects and be ready to explain them.

βœ… Take mock interviews to improve communication.

βœ… Use skill assessments to identify weak areas.

Improvement comes from consistency rather than trying to learn everything at once.
